Standard Chartered Executes Share Buy-back to Optimize Capital Structure

Standard Chartered ( (GB:STAN) ) has shared an announcement.

Standard Chartered PLC has executed a share buy-back program, purchasing 1,150,000 of its ordinary shares at prices ranging from 1,183.5 to 1,199.0 GB pence. The company plans to cancel these shares, reducing the total number of shares in issue to 2,395,673,854, which will also be the total number of voting rights. This move is part of a strategic effort to manage the company’s share capital and potentially enhance shareholder value.

More about Standard Chartered

Standard Chartered PLC is a multinational banking and financial services company headquartered in London, England. It operates primarily in Asia, Africa, and the Middle East, providing a range of services including personal banking, corporate banking, and wealth management.
